Nekahi, Azam

Dr Azam Nekahi

Dr Azam Nekahi

Lecturer
  • +44 141 273 1767
  • Azam.Nekahi@gcu.ac.uk
Dr. Azam Nekahi has been a lecturer in the School of Computing, Engineering and Built Environment at Glasgow Caledonian University since 2014. She received a BSc degree in Electrical Engineering from the Amirkabir University of Technology (Tehran's Polytechnic) in 2004. She obtained Masters and PhD degrees, respectively in 2007 and 2011 at the Université du Québec; Canada within the NSERC/Hydro-Quebec/UQAC Industrial Chair on Atmospheric Icing of Power Network Equipment (CIGELE). Dr. Nekahi worked as a research fellow at GCU from 2012 to 2014. Her main research interests include outdoor insulation, partial discharge and spectroscopy. Dr. Nekahi is an active member of IEEE-DEIS and WIE.

In 2012 Dr. Nekahi was appointed as the liaison between IEEE Dielectrics and Electrical Insulation Society (DEIS) and IEEE Women in Engineering (WIE) Committee. The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(IEEE) is the world's largest professional association for the advancement of technology. IEEE Women in Engineering (WIE) is the largest international professional organisation dedicated to promoting womenengineers and scientists.

Alongside her career, Dr. Nekahi runs the GCU staff's netball club.
